Stories are more than 22 times more memorable to interviewers than facts alone. If you're looking to land your dream role, then this Jolt session is right for you.

Together, we’ll learn how to harness the scope of our accomplishments and abilities into interesting, dynamic and impactful stories that will leave your interviewer impressed and engaged.


In this Jolt session, Madison Salters teaches us how to craft our narrative, create a ready-to-go deck for any interview question, and refine our techniques for any audience or role.

Who is Madison Salters?

An award-winning journalist, editor, writer, documentarian, and translator, Madison Salters has been published across major new outlets and literary magazines, including The Huffington Post, TripAdvisor, and the United Nations Press. She is the Editor-in-Chief of Peter Gabriel's The Toolbox, and Nonfiction Editor of Ruminate Magazine. Named "Top 30 Under 30" by Westchester Magazine, Innovator of the Year by UCL and SOAS of London, and a UNESCO Ambassador of Peace and Cross-Cultural Dialogue, she is a sought-after public speaker.
